Transaction 59c77561d44d694eb90cc82f8257f0a2174205367e453355e2d83c178564a7d9
1 Input
1 Output
-
59c77561d44d694eb90cc82f8257f0a2174205367e453355e2d83c178564a7d9:0
- value
- 39322
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6788241c890b99936ee2b3503b39e2226b311fd6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ASRh1JdtUHWY9spVZnAUezh8g2irX3uA2